Blasdell standoff ends peacefully
November 13, 2009, 6:46 AM / A 7 1/2-hour standoff in Blasdell ended peacefully early Thursday morning when a 39-year-old Lake Avenue man surrendered his loaded shotgun and then walked out of his house without incident.
A man who authorities sayA held Village of Blasdell police and Town of Hamburg SWAT team and negotiators at bay for more than seven hours Wednesday night and ThursdayA morning was taken into custody without incident.A His name has not been released and there is no word on the charges he could face.
